Tanimu ready to serve after first Eagles call up

By Daily Sports Nigeria on March 11, 2024

Tanzania-based defender Benjamin Tanimu is eager to wear the national team jersey for the Super Eagles after he was handed his first call up into the team on Saturday, PUNCH Sports Extra reports.

The former Bendel Insurance defender was named among the 27 players invited for the friendly matches against Ghana and Mali in Morocco later this month.

Nigeria will take on West African rivals Ghana at the Grand Stade de Marrakech on Friday March 22 and also play on Tuesday March 26.

In anticipation of his meeting with some of the players he calls his idol, the 21-year-old centre back is rearing to go in the national team after featuring for the U-23 team last year.

“It’s God’s doing,” Tanimu told PUNCH Sports Extra.

“This time last year, I was also invited to the U-23 team. I’m glad to have been invited to the Super Eagles of Nigeria for the upcoming international friendlies against Mali and Ghana. It’s huge progress for my career.

“Clarion call heard and I’m ready to serve Nigeria with all strength,” he said.

Before joining Ihefu of Tanzania in January, Tanimu was a consistent figure in Bendel Insurance’s defence in the Nigeria Premier League since their promotion to the topflight in 2023.

He scored two goals in 19 appearances before making the move and was also part of their unprecedented 21-game unbeaten run in the league last season.

He also played a key role in their 2023 Federation Cup triumph.
